Supplier Contract Renewal — Finance Review

Prepared for the incoming director.

The Korvath Materials contract expires in November. Current terms: fixed pricing, 24-month lock, 4% annual escalator. Spend last year: 3.2m. Korvath has signalled a 9% increase on renewal. Alternatives (Ferrelin, Oastway) quote lower but carry qualification risk. Recommendation: renew for 12 months only, pending dual-sourcing review. Rationale connects to a broader plan:

board note of bajop-yaweg: The western region missed its Pelys quota by 58.0 percent last quarter. Pelysek Foods plans to raise the Belius list price by 44.0 percent in July. The steering committee signed off on a budget of $133.8 million for Project Pelax. The renewal with Zoraelix Systems closes at $61.9 million a year, 12.7 percent above the last contract.

### Action item: slim the builder images

Following the Greywharf outage, we agreed to shrink the Pondry build images — the fat images were the main reason node pulls blew past the deploy window. New folks: we now build from a minimal base, strip debug symbols, and prune layer caches on a schedule. Don't add tools to the base image without a ticket. The size budgets and cache settings we landed on are below.

limits module of fajog-tawig:
RATE_LIMITS = {
    "druwyn": 2,
    "quenael": 10,
    "wenix": 2,
    "druael": 2,
}

Minutes — Management Meeting, Harwick Branch Network. Attendees: R. Calloway, M. Drennan, S. Ives. Topic: lease renegotiation at the Pellbrook site. Landlord offered a five-year term with a rent step-down in year two; we pushed back on the service charge. Marta will circulate the counter-proposal by Friday. Branch managers should hold off on fit-out orders until terms settle. One more item before we close — the confidential business note is set out below.

board note of kageg-bahof: The renewal with Holwynax Holdings closes at $2 million a year, 5 percent below the last contract. Project Ulaath slips by two quarters because of the supplier delay.